Stereopony (ステレオポニー Sutereoponī?) is a Japanese rock band that formed in Okinawa in 2007, consisting of Aimi (lead guitar/lead vocals), Nohana (bass guitar), and Shiho (Drums). They are signed onto Sony Music Japan's gr8! Records music label.

The band gained their first opportunity on the Japanese rock radio program School of Lock!. Their song "Hitohira no Hanabira" (ヒトヒラのハナビラ) was the 17th ending theme for the anime series Bleach.[1][2] Their first single was released on November 5, 2008.[3] It ranked 25th on the Oricon Weekly Charts.[4] They have also performed "Namida no Mukō" (泪のムコウ?), the second opening theme for the second season of the Sunrise series Mobile Suit Gundam 00; it ranked second in the Oricon charts.

Their single, "I do it", is a collaboration with fellow Sony Music Japan singer Yui, was released on April 22, 2009.[5] Their debut studio album Hydrangea ga Saiteiru was released on June 17, 2009 and ranked #7 on the Oricon weekly charts. Their latest single "Tsukiakari no Michishirube" is the opening theme to the second season of the anime series Darker than Black; it ranked #8 on Oricon.
